如何在 CentOS 上安装 Apache Hadoop

2025-10-19 20:50:52

1、在安装 hadoop 前,请确保你的系统上安装了 Java。使用此命令检查已安装 Java 的版本,下图说明没有安装java

如何在 CentOS 上安装 Apache Hadoop

2、要安装java,需要从 Oracle 官方网站下载最新版本的 java用命令:wget 如下图

如何在 CentOS 上安装 Apache Hadoop

如何在 CentOS 上安装 Apache Hadoop

3、需要设置使用更新版本的 Java 作为替代。使用以下命令来执行此操作。

如何在 CentOS 上安装 Apache Hadoop

4、现在你可能还需要使用 alternatives 命令设置 javac 和 jar 命令路径:

alternatives --install /usr/bin/jar jar /opt/jdk1.7.0_79/bin/jar 2

alternatives --install /usr/bin/javac javac /opt/jdk1.7.0_79/bin/javac 2

alternatives --set jar /opt/jdk1.7.0_79/bin/jar

alternatives --set javac /opt/jdk1.7.0_79/bin/javac

如何在 CentOS 上安装 Apache Hadoop

5、下一步是配置环境变量。使用以下命令正确设置这些变量。

设置 JAVA_HOME 、JRE_HOME 、PATH 如图

如何在 CentOS 上安装 Apache Hadoop

1、创建用于 hadoop 安装的系统用户帐户,命令useradd hadoop passwd hadoop

如何在 CentOS 上安装 Apache Hadoop

2、现在从官方网站 hadoop 下载 hadoop 最新的可用版本

如何在 CentOS 上安装 Apache Hadoop

3、下一步是设置 hadoop 使用的环境变量。

编辑 ~/.bashrc,并在文件末尾添加以下这些值

export HADOOP_HOME=/home/hadoop/hadoop

export HADOOP_INSTALL=$HADOOP_HOME

export HADOOP_MAPRED_HOME=$HADOOP_HOME

export HADOOP_COMMON_HOME=$HADOOP_HOME

export HADOOP_HDFS_HOME=$HADOOP_HOME

export YARN_HOME=$HADOOP_HOME

export HADOOP_COMMON_LIB_NATIVE_DIR=$HADOOP_HOME/lib/native

export PATH=$PATH:$HADOOP_HOME/sbin:$HADOOP_HOME/bin

如何在 CentOS 上安装 Apache Hadoop

4、编辑 $HADOOP_HOME/etc/hadoop/hadoop-env.sh 并设置 JAVA_HOME 环境变量。

export JAVA_HOME=/opt/jdk1.7.0_79/

如何在 CentOS 上安装 Apache Hadoop

5、首先编辑 hadoop 配置文件并进行以下更改core-site.xml,hdfs-site.xml,mapred-site.xml,yarn-site.xml

如何在 CentOS 上安装 Apache Hadoop

如何在 CentOS 上安装 Apache Hadoop

如何在 CentOS 上安装 Apache Hadoop

如何在 CentOS 上安装 Apache Hadoop

6、cd /home/hadoop/hadoop/sbin/

start-dfs.sh

start-yarn.sh

启动完成如下图所示

如何在 CentOS 上安装 Apache Hadoop

声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
相关推荐
  • 阅读量:104
  • 阅读量:171
  • 阅读量:140
  • 阅读量:151
  • 阅读量:156
  • 猜你喜欢